The Justice Action Network released a poll that shows likely voters nationwide overwhelmingly support federal reforms under consideration by the U.S. Senate to fix the nation’s criminal justice system. Voters strongly believe that, as a result of mandatory minimum practices, our current system imprisons too many people for too long and that judges should have greater discretion in determining sentences. The poll, conducted by The Tarrance Group, surveyed likely voters in the states of Florida, North Carolina, Nevada, Kentucky, Missouri and Wisconsin, and reveals virtually equal support for reform among Republican and Democratic voters, as well as overwhelming bipartisan agreement that the goal of our criminal justice system should be rehabilitation.
Read poll results
Listen to conference call
View polling presentation